Another high-profile departure appears imminent as Manchester United prepare for a major summer overhaul under the INEOS regime.
Unpopular midfielder Manuel Ugarte is actively planning a summer move from Old Trafford, according to Sky Sports journalist Florian Plettenberg.
Despite being under contract until 2029, the 25-year-old Uruguay international has been completely marginalized in Manchester, opening the door to an intense bidding war led by Turkish giants Galatasaray.
Ugarte’s time in Manchester has been extremely frustrating since joining from Paris Saint-Germain for £50.5m in August 2024.

The ball-winning midfielder initially struggled to adapt to the pace of the Premier League, but things have only gotten worse since Michael Carrick took over the managerial reins from Ruben Amorim.
Under Carrick’s progressive management, Ugarte only started when Coby Mainu was injured and was an unused substitute in recent important wins against Chelsea, Brentford and Liverpool.
Behind the scenes, the club’s hierarchy has already made the final decision. Widespread reports suggest that Sir Jim Ratcliffe personally approved Ugarte’s impending sale.
With veteran Casemiro also set to leave the club, Man United will be looking to sign a new midfielder in the summer transfer window.

In order to raise this money, United are prepared to ruthlessly cut their losses against Ugarte.
Although his stock may have declined in England, Ugarte’s attacking and combative profile remains highly coveted across Europe. Galatasaray are currently the most concrete suitors.
As Plettenberg pointed out, Super Lig’s leading players held extensive and specific talks about a transfer earlier this year, but the move ultimately fell through.
With the summer season approaching, Ugarte is actively looking for a way out and the Turkish club is ready to return to the negotiating table.
